sâmbătă, aprilie 08, 2006

Cum postezi un mesaj fara sh, tz, si alte semne care se vad urat pe grupuri de discutii

Mica introducere. Sunt doua formate ale textului care ne intereseaza:
)> Unicode (suporta orice semn imaginabil, inclusiv euro, sh, tz si semne cu accente samd);
)> Codarea western european (Windows/ISO);

Exista si alte formate: Central European, Chinese samd.

Sh si Tz sunt doua caractere care se vad bine in Unicode si in Central European.

Problema: trimit un mesaj cu sh si tz, ajunge pe grupuri de discutii sa arate foarte urat (ceva de genul &amd; sau &tilda)
Exemplu de text:
Am vãzut astãzi un cer splendit.Din pãcate timpul frumos nu a þinut mult. Parcã ºtiam cã aºa se va întâmpla.Presimþisem.

Solutia?
Trebuie convertit textul din Unicode intr-un format universal. Sh-ul sa devina s, Tz-ul sa devina t. O solutie ar fi sa inlocuiti manual sh cu s si restul caracterelor. Alta ar fi sa dati Search & Replace (Ctrl + H in multe editoare de text).
Insa Notepad este un accesoriu care poate face acest lucru rapid.

Asadar, metoda rapida:
Start -> Run -> Accessories -> Notepad (sau, mai rapid: Windows + R - pentru Run - si tastati Notepad Enter)
Copiati textul pentru care vreti sa scapati de sh si tz (Ctrl + C).
Paste in Notepad (Ctrl + V);
File -> Save as... (fara scurtatura din pacate);
Un nume aleator. Enter.
Va intreaba: O sa salvez fara unicode! Vreti asta? OK.
File -> Open -> Fisierul tocmai salvat;
Ctrl + A (select all), Ctrl + C (copy);
Paste (Ctrl + V) unde vreti sa puneti textul fara sh si tz.

Asadar, metoda pe scurt, aproape numai din tastatura:
1. Selectare text de convertit (daca e cazul, folositi Ctrl + A);
2. Ctrl + C; Windows + R; Notepad; Enter; Ctrl + V; Alt + F; A; Nume aleator; OK; Alt + F; O; selectare fisier; Ctrl + A (e posibil sa nu mearga aceasta optiune, in acest caz: Edit -> Select All); Ctrl + C; Ctrl + V.